[jboss-cvs] JBossAS SVN: r71708 - proj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Thu Apr 3 14:12:30 EDT 2008
Author: anil.saldhana at jboss.com
Date: 2008-04-03 14:12:30 -0400 (Thu, 03 Apr 2008)
New Revision: 71708
Modified:
proj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eImpl.java
proj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eMarshaller.java
Log:
minor refactor
Modified: proj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eImpl.java
===================================================================
--- proj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eImpl.java 2008-04-03 18:10:59 UTC (rev 71707)
+++ proj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eImpl.java 2008-04-03 18:12:30 UTC (rev 71708)
@@ -121,7 +121,7 @@
XMLConstants.XSI_NS, "type", XMLConstants.XSI_PREFIX);
xsiAttr.setTextContent("xacml-samlp:XACMLAuthzDecisionStatement");
element.setAttributeNodeNS(xsiAttr);
-
+
return element;
}
}
\ No newline at end of file
Modified: proj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eMarshaller.java
===================================================================
--- proj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eMarshaller.java 2008-04-03 18:10:59 UTC (rev 71707)
+++ projects/security/security-xacml/trunk/jboss-xacml-saml/src/main/java/org/jboss/security/xacml/saml/integration/opensaml/impl/XACMLAuthzDecisionStatementTypeMarshaller.java 2008-04-03 18:12:30 UTC (rev 71708)
@@ -29,6 +29,7 @@
import org.opensaml.xml.XMLObject;
import org.opensaml.xml.io.MarshallingException;
import org.opensaml.xml.util.XMLHelper;
+import org.w3c.dom.Document;
import org.w3c.dom.Element;
import org.w3c.dom.Node;
@@ -46,7 +47,8 @@
{
XACMLAuthzDecisionStatementType xacmlType = (XACMLAuthzDecisionStatementType) xmlObject;
- Element xacmlDecisionElement = xacmlType.asElement(parentElement.getOwnerDocument());
+ Document ownerDocument = parentElement.getOwnerDocument();
+ Element xacmlDecisionElement = xacmlType.asElement(ownerDocument);
parentElement.appendChild(xacmlDecisionElement);
@@ -56,7 +58,7 @@
Node responseRoot = responseContext.getDocumentElement();
if(responseRoot != null)
{
- XMLHelper.adoptElement((Element) responseRoot, parentElement.getOwnerDocument());
+ XMLHelper.adoptElement((Element) responseRoot, ownerDocument);
xacmlDecisionElement.appendChild(responseRoot);
}
else
@@ -64,7 +66,7 @@
try
{
Element elem = JBossXACMLUtil.getResponseContextElement(responseContext);
- XMLHelper.adoptElement(elem, parentElement.getOwnerDocument());
+ XMLHelper.adoptElement(elem, ownerDocument);
xacmlDecisionElement.appendChild(elem);
}
catch (Exception e)
@@ -80,7 +82,7 @@
Node requestRoot = requestContext.getDocumentElement();
if(requestRoot != null)
{
- XMLHelper.adoptElement((Element) requestRoot, parentElement.getOwnerDocument());
+ XMLHelper.adoptElement((Element) requestRoot, ownerDocument);
xacmlDecisionElement.appendChild(requestRoot);
}
}
More information about the jboss-cvs-commits
mailing list